48 Hours........................Eddie Murphy has a late 50's Speedster.
A Life Less Ordinary....A gold 928 in the garage at the dentist's house.
A Time to Kill...............Sandra Bullock drives a dark green 356 cabriolet.
Against All Odds...........Ferrari 308GTS and 911SC Cabrio street race.
American Dreamer........A slate gray '64 356SC cabriolet.
American Psycho...........Running from cops, Bale passes a mid '80's 911 Targa.
Arthur............................Dudley drives a 924GTU, plus some 911s in other scenes.
